Te Tūranga | About the role
As a Head of City Operations, you’ll play a key role in turning strategy into action. Reporting to our General Manager for Operations and Infrastructure, you’ll lead operational teams that deliver services our community relies on every day – keeping Tauranga’s spaces, places and services safe, well‑maintained and running smoothly.
This is a hands‑on leadership role where you’ll balance people leadership, operational performance and continuous improvement. You’ll work closely with internal partners and external contractors to deliver agreed programmes on time, within budget and to the standards our community expects.
In this role, you’ll:
- Lead and develop operational teams to deliver high‑quality services
- Drive a strong safety culture that prioritises health, wellbeing and accountability
- Manage operational plans, budgets and performance outcomes
- Build positive relationships with stakeholders, contractors and partners
- Nurture and cultivate the culture of continuous improvement, doing the right thing and taking pride in your work. Look for ways to encourage and drive your team to continue to seek continuous improvement in their roles.
Ngā Pukenga | What you’ll need to succeed
To succeed in this role, you’ll bring:
- Senior operational leadership experience leading complex service delivery portfolios, including leading other leaders in multi‑disciplinary environments.
- A proven ability to integrate, streamline and lift operational performance — improving systems and ways of working without creating unnecessary disruption or bureaucracy.
- A people‑centred change leadership style, delivering results while strengthening culture, health, safety, wellbeing and capability.
- Strong financial, commercial and risk acumen, with confidence owning budgets, performance reporting and decision‑making in a public accountability context.
- The executive presence and judgement to engage credibly at senior level — contributing to briefings, papers and presentations, and working effectively with contractors, unions, iwi, stakeholders and the wider community.
This role suits a leader who improves how complex operations work — strengthening systems, culture and delivery at the same time. Someone who not necessarily comes from the same industry or background but embraces challenge and seeks continuous improvement.
